How to check a used Google Pixel in Morocco
Moroccan networks, heat, display, battery, cameras and imported variants: the checks a Pixel needs.
Test a used Pixel with your own SIM: call, data, VoLTE when available, Wi‑Fi and GPS. Then check heat, fingerprint, battery, display and repair history before reset.
Step 1
Identify the imported variant
Pixels are often imported; variant and operator can change network behaviour.
- Record the exact model number.
- Test with the SIM you will use.
- Do not promise 5G or VoLTE without a real operator test.
Step 2
Test heat, battery and display
Smooth menus do not reveal problems under load.
- Record video for five minutes, then use mobile data.
- Watch battery drop and abnormal heat.
- Use solid colours and test fingerprint repeatedly.
Step 3
Check Pixel functions
The camera is a strength, but every sensor and processing step must work.
- Test main, ultra-wide, selfie and video.
- Check stabilisation, microphone and speakers.
- Reset only after the Google account is removed.

FAQ
Common questions
Does Pixel 5G always work in Morocco?
Do not assume it. It depends on model, software and operator; test the exact variant.
Is Pixel heat normal?
Light warmth can happen; throttling, shutdown or excessive heat are warnings.
Should I avoid an imported Pixel?
Not automatically, but variant, network, invoice and parts availability must be clear.
